Substance Abuse In Renton & King County, Washington

All counties throughout the state of Washington, including King County, deal with substance abuse problems. These facts illustrate the severity of the problem within Renton and the surrounding area:

  • In 2018, King County saw a total of 279 deaths related to drug overdose. More than half of these deaths involved the use of opioids.
  • The overall overdose death rate for King County in 2017 was 14.1 per 100,000 residents.
  • In 2017, King County saw a total of 1,460 hospitalizations related to drug overdose or abuse.
